San Antonio’s caliche soil can cause stucco to crack because it expands and contracts with changes in moisture, creating movement in the foundation and walls above it. As the stucco shifts, cracks can form and return even after they are covered with fresh paint. Paint may hide minor surface imperfections, but it cannot correct the underlying movement or repair damaged stucco, which is why proper crack repair and surface preparation are necessary for a lasting finish.
This is one of the most overlooked reasons stucco keeps cracking across San Antonio. Most homeowners blame old age or bad paint. The real cause is often right under their feet.
The Texas Department of Insurance and local soil surveys have long noted that large parts of Bexar County sit on caliche and expansive clay layers, which are known to cause foundation movement in homes across Central Texas. This is not a rare problem. It is a regional one.

What Caliche Soil Is and Why It’s Common in San Antonio?
How Caliche Forms and Where It’s Most Prevalent Locally
Caliche is a hard, chalky layer of soil. It forms when calcium carbonate builds up in the ground over a long time. Rain washes minerals down. The minerals settle and harden. Over many years, this creates a cement-like layer under the topsoil.
San Antonio sits on a mix of limestone and caliche-rich soil. This is common in areas near the Hill Country edge, including neighborhoods around Stone Oak, Alamo Heights, and parts of the Northwest Side. Builders often hit this hard layer when digging foundations.
Why It Behaves Differently From Typical Clay Soil
Caliche is hard when dry. But it is not stable. It still absorbs water, just slower than clay. When it finally does absorb water, it can shift in an uneven way. Some parts of the foundation stay firm. Other parts sink or lift slightly.
This uneven movement is worse than steady, even movement. It puts twisting pressure on a foundation. That twisting pressure is what usually cracks stucco walls.
How Soil Movement Leads to Stucco Cracking?
Foundation Shift Patterns Tied to Caliche Expansion and Contraction
Stucco is rigid. It does not stretch. When the foundation under it shifts even a small amount, the stucco has nowhere to go but crack.
Common patterns homeowners see:
- Diagonal cracks near window and door corners
- Stair-step cracks along stucco seams
- Cracks that widen after heavy rain, then seem to close up in dry months
These patterns point to soil movement, not just surface wear.
Why Hairline Cracks Often Return After Repainting?
A fresh coat of paint can hide a hairline crack for a while. But paint has almost no flexibility. As soon as the soil shifts again, the same spot cracks open. This is why so many San Antonio homeowners find themselves repainting the same wall every year or two.
Why Repainting Alone Doesn’t Solve the Underlying Problem?
The Difference Between Cosmetic Patching and Structural Repair
Cosmetic patching fills the crack and paints over it. It looks good for a short time. It does nothing to address the soil movement causing the crack.
Structural repair looks at why the crack formed. It may involve:
- Proper crack routing and filling with flexible material
- Checking for ongoing foundation movement
- Addressing drainage issues that feed water to the soil under the slab
Skipping straight to paint is like covering a leak with a towel instead of fixing the pipe.
When to Bring in a Foundation Specialist First
If you notice any of these signs, get a foundation specialist involved before repainting:
- Cracks wider than a quarter inch
- Doors or windows that stick or no longer close right
- Cracks that keep growing over a few months
- Visible gaps between the stucco and window trim
A quick inspection can save you from repainting a wall that will just crack again.
The Right Repair Sequence Before Repainting Stucco
Crack Assessment and Elastomeric Patching Methods
Every crack should be checked before it gets patched. Small hairline cracks are usually fine to patch directly. Larger or repeating cracks need a closer look at the cause.
Once the cause is addressed, the repair process usually includes:
- Cleaning out the crack
- Filling it with a flexible patching compound
- Smoothing it to match the surrounding texture
- Letting it cure fully before any coating goes on
Rushing this step is one of the biggest reasons stucco repairs fail early.
Choosing Flexible Coatings Suited to Soil-Movement Areas
Standard paint is rigid. In soil-movement areas like much of San Antonio, elastomeric coatings work better. They stretch slightly with small foundation shifts instead of cracking right away.
If your home has a history of stucco cracking, ask about elastomeric coating options before your next repaint. It is a small upgrade that can add years of protection.
